Measuring Success: Key Metrics and Validation Methods for Alcohol Curation Brands

Important Performance Metrics to Track

Metric What It Measures Example Benchmarks
Conversion Rate Percentage of visitors who become leads/customers 3-5% on optimized landing pages
Cost Per Lead (CPL) Average cost to acquire a qualified lead $15-$40 depending on segment
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C) Total marketing spend divided by customers acquired Keep below $100
Return on Ad Spend (ROAS) Revenue generated per dollar spent on ads 4x or higher
Attribution Data Completeness Accuracy of conversion tracking Aim for 90%+
Customer Feedback Score Average satisfaction rating from surveys and polls 4+ stars or 80%+ positive

Common Pitfalls to Avoid When Building Your Online Presence

  • Overreliance on Last-Click Attribution: This can misallocate budgets by ignoring earlier touchpoints.
  • Ignoring Compliance Requirements: Non-compliant ads risk suspensions and fines.
  • Poor Data Hygiene: Incorrect pixel setups or tracking errors lead to flawed insights.
  • Generic Messaging: Lack of personalization reduces engagement and conversions.
  • Neglecting Feedback Loops: Missing real-time customer insights slows optimization (tools like Zigpoll help close this gap).
  • Manual Lead Nurturing: Inconsistent follow-ups without automation reduce conversion potential.
  • Overspending on Underperforming Channels: Data-driven budget allocation is essential to maximize ROI.

How do I ensure compliance in alcohol performance marketing?

Understand platform-specific rules and legal regulations. Implement age gating, restrict targeting to legal drinking ages, and avoid prohibited claims to maintain compliance.
